MSA announced today the hiring of Bob Haines, PE, as a new senior engineering project manager within the firm’s Baraboo, Wisconsin, office location.

Bob joins MSA with over 36 years of experience in municipal leadership and administration, public works and transportation engineering design, project management, water and wastewater operations, regulatory compliance, municipal budgeting, and the management of a variety of municipal department staff. He brings a deep bench of expertise to the role of senior engineering project manager at MSA, including a 13-year tenure with the City of La Crosse, Wisconsin, as the assistant director of public works and engineer IV, nine years as the director of public works in the Village of Holmen, Wisconsin, and eight years as a senior transportation engineer with the Waukesha County, Wisconsin, Department of Public Works.
Bob holds a bachelor’s degree in civil engineering from the University of Wisconsin-Platteville. He is a licensed Professional Engineer in Minnesota and Wisconsin, a Certified Wastewater Operator in Wisconsin, and Certified Municipal Water Supply Operator in Wisconsin.
